About This Property
Located@ 825 Parker Blvd. #403 Two Story 2 Bedroom 2 Bath-1 full/1 half Central Air - Central Heat. Yard Appliances - Refrigerator, Stove, Microwave and Dishwasher Washer /Dryer Hook ups Washer/Dryer Rental Available at additional $55/month Detached 2 Car Garage Near Saylorville Lake, Bike Trails, TCI golf Course Lawn Care and Snow Removal Included Rent $1,395/mo for 2 year lease or $1,445/mo for 1 year lease Deposit 1 Months Rent $1,395/$1,445 NO SMOKING INSIDE PROPERTY!! 1 Small Pet Allowed Per Property 25 pounds and under with $500 Pet Fee Plus extra $45/month Rent Call or Text AUSTIN to set up a viewing
825 Parker Blvd is a townhome located in Polk County and the 50226 ZIP Code. This area is served by the North Polk Community School District attendance zone.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
